Hire a Certified Hacker: Why You Need to Consider It for Your Cybersecurity Needs
In the digital age, the sophistication of cyber risks has actually grown tremendously, leading many organizations to seek expert support in protecting their sensitive details. One of the most effective methods that companies are investing in is working with a certified hacker. While it might sound counterproductive to get the assistance of somebody who is traditionally seen as a threat, certified hackers-- typically referred to as ethical hackers or penetration testers-- play a crucial function in strengthening cybersecurity measures.
What is a Certified Hacker?
A certified hacker is a professional trained in ethical hacking methods, and is frequently certified through reputable organizations. These people utilize their skills to assist companies identify vulnerabilities in their systems, remedy weak points, and safeguard sensitive information from malicious attacks.

Proactive Risk Assessment
Working with a certified hacker allows companies to take a proactive method to cybersecurity. By recognizing vulnerabilities before they can be made use of, services can substantially decrease their risk of experiencing a data breach.

Know-how in Threat Analysis
Certified hackers have deep insights into the most recent hacking approaches, tools, and risks. This expertise enables them to imitate real-world attacks and assist companies comprehend their possible vulnerabilities.

Regulative Compliance
Many markets go through stringent regulatory requirements concerning information security. A certified hacker can help organizations abide by these guidelines, preventing large fines and keeping customer trust.

Occurrence Response
In the occasion of a security breach, a certified hacker can be crucial in incident response efforts. They can assist investigate how the breach occurred, what information was jeopardized, and how to prevent similar events in the future.

Training and Awareness
Certified hackers typically supply training for internal staff on finest practices in cybersecurity. By increasing awareness of security dangers and preventive measures, companies can cultivate a culture of cybersecurity vigilance.

Picking the ideal certified hacker can make a considerable difference in the effectiveness of your cybersecurity efforts. Here are some essential factors to think about:

Relevant Certifications
Make sure that the hacker possesses pertinent accreditations that match your specific needs. Different accreditations indicate different skills and levels of expertise.

Industry Experience
Search for a hacker who has experience working within your industry. Familiarity with specific regulative requirements and typical threats in your sector can add significant worth.

Track record and References
Research study the hacker's credibility and request for referrals or case studies from previous clients. This can provide insights into their effectiveness and dependability.

Approach and Tools
Understand the approaches and tools they use during their evaluations. A certified hacker ought to utilize a mix of automated and manual strategies to cover all angles.

Interaction Skills
Effective communication is essential. The hacker ought to have the ability to convey complex technical details in a manner that is understandable to your team.
Common Misconceptions About Certified Hackers
Hacker = Criminal
Numerous people relate hackers with criminal activity. However, certified hackers operate fairly, with the specific approval of the companies they assist.

It's All About Technology
While technical abilities are crucial, reliable ethical hacking also involves understanding human habits, security policies, and threat management.

One-Time Assessment Suffices
Cybersecurity is a continuous procedure. Organizations needs to regularly evaluate their security posture through constant monitoring and regular evaluations.
